HAZARD RATING FOR YOUR FACILITY: Low (≤15) Total Score = 14
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
302 - Equipment/utensils/food contact surfaces not properly washed and sanitized [s. 17(2)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): No quats sanitizer detected in sanitizer spray bottle in pizza prep area.
Corrective Action(s): Refill sanitizer bottle immediately. 200 ppm Quats required.
*test quats sanitizer each time it is dispensed into spray bottles to ensure that 200 ppm is dispensed.
Correction date: Immediately
Violation Score: 5

Non-Critical Hazards: Total Number: 3
306 - Food premises not maintained in a sanitary condition [s. 17(1)]
Observation: Flour and dirt accumulation noted under prep tables and storage shelves.
Corrective Action(s): Thoroughly clean above noted areas.
Remove unused rubber mats so that area under shelves can be thoroughly cleaned.
Correction date: Jan 15/18
Violation Score: 3

307 - Equipment/utensils/food contact surfaces are not of suitable design/material [s. 16; s. 19]
Observation: Flour bin does not appear to be constructed of food grade materials.
Corrective Action(s): Obtain a storage bin that is constructed of food grade materials and intended for food storage. (Or provide documentation that indicates current container is intended for food storage.)
**This has been mentioned in previous inspection reports.
Correction date: Jan 15/18
Violation Score: 3

403 - Employee lacks good personal hygiene, clean clothing and hair control [s. 21(1)]
Observation: Do not store aprons in staff washroom or on dirty surfaces i.e. step ladder.
Corrective Action(s): Store aprons in a clean area, away from potential contamination.
Ensure that aprons are laundered regularly.
Correction date: Jan 8/18
Violation Score: 3

Comments

-Handsinks supplied with hot & cold water, liquid soap and paper towels.
-Pizza Prep Cooler and Inserts: <4 deg. C
-Condiment Cooler: 3 deg. C
-Walk-In Cooler: 2 deg. C
*Temperature records do not appear to be maintained --> maintain temperature records as per your Food Safety Plan.
-Food Storage practices appear satisfactory - food is protected from contamination.
-Proper manual dishwashing and sanitizing procedures reviewed with operator - no concerns.
-No pest activity noted. Monthly pest control services provided by Poulin's Pest Control - recent service report reviewed - no concerns.

Note: Hand sanitizer noted at handsinks. Discussed with operator - ensure staff do not replace handwashing with hand sanitizer. Review handwashing practices with staff. Hand sanitizer should not be used in food handling settings.
